### Step 6: Archive Cold Storage Buckets

Before archiving any Vaultmere cold storage bucket, confirm the retention manifest matches the inventory snapshot and that no legal holds are active. The archive job writes an immutable index, which must be signed for the audit trail to validate. After the index is generated, sign it with the key below.

rollout seal: bky9_aBG1gvAyU

Hey — quick handover before you review my patch. The Quillbarn build agents have been drifting apart; agent-7 runs about ninety seconds fast, which makes artifact timestamps look like they come from the future and the cache invalidation freaks out. I've pinned everything to the Tindell time service and added a skew check on agent startup. If anything looks off in the diff, flag it to the person named below.

account owner for bawip-tahag: Raleth Quenok

Subject: Feedlark handover

Handing off Feedlark, our podcast feed validator, ahead of the 2.4 release. Outstanding: one medium finding on XML entity handling, patched and awaiting your sign-off. Release artifacts are built on the Ostwick runner and signed at upload. Verification docs are in the repo wiki. For your review, the current signing key is below.

rollout seal: bky4_x7Gc